The Right Type for Your LifestyleRefrigerators come in various setups, each accommodating various family sizes and storage routines:Single Door: Best for bachelors or little households with minimal area.Double Door (Top/Bottom Freezer): The most popular choice for mid-sized families; deals better organization and larger freezer capacities.Side-by-Side: Ideal for big households who purchase wholesale and appreciate high-end visual appeal.French Door: Combines the very Best Fridges of both worlds with a wide fridge compartment on top and a pull-out freezer drawer below, offering remarkable storage flexibility.2. Capacity: How Much Space Do You Need?Capacity is measured in liters (L). Choosing the incorrect size can cause wasted energy (if too huge) or food spoilage (if too little).Household SizeSuggested Capacity (L)1-- 2 People150L-- 250L3 People250L-- 350L4 People350L-- 500L5+ People500L+3. Energy EfficiencyConsidering that a refrigerator runs 24/7, its energy performance ranking substantially affects your regular monthly electrical power bill. Always look for high-star ratings (e.g., 5-star energy labels). While these models might have a greater upfront cost, the long-term cost savings on utility expenses make them more economical.4. Vital Features to Look ForModern refrigerators are loaded with technology developed to simplify life. Watch out for these functions:Inverter Compressors: These immediately change speed based upon cooling need, resulting in quiet operation and lower power consumption.Frost-Free Technology: Eliminates the requirement for manual defrosting, avoiding ice accumulation.Convertible Modes: Allows you to alter a freezer area into a fridge section, supplying extra area during social gatherings or vacations.Water and Ice Dispensers: A practical luxury, though installation requires a dedicated water line connection.Measuring Your Space: The Golden RuleAmong the most common mistakes when buying online is stopping working to measure the designated space. Follow these actions to prevent a delivery headache:Width, Depth, and Height: Measure the exact location where the fridge will sit.Clearance Space: Add a minimum of 2-- 3 inches on all sides for appropriate ventilation. Without this, the compressor will overheat, resulting in minimized effectiveness and poor cooling.Entrance Clearance: Measure your doorways, hallways, and stairs to guarantee the delivery team can really get the fridge into your kitchen area.The Pros and Cons of Online Refrigerator ShoppingProsConsBig range of brand names and designsCan not touch or feel the productSincere user reviews and scoresDelivery timelines can be unpredictableCompetitive pricing and frequent salesSetup might require manual effort or schedulingDetailed technical requirements suppliedReturning big appliances can be complicatedTips for a Smooth Online PurchaseInspect the Warranty: Ensure you comprehend what is covered under the maker's guarantee.
